Output 2850305efd7f69b795438f318e4c124acf8b800d905b0dd45410c441c2ae7c76:38

value
517649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cee13970d8fb240b16ba82550d29a6daa988405e OP_EQUAL
address
3LYtvvbp8Wr5VKd1oP9sb59AgMyV1AUJ3X
transaction
2850305efd7f69b795438f318e4c124acf8b800d905b0dd45410c441c2ae7c76
spent
true